Introduction: Comparing Traditional Poaching with Sous Vide

Traditional poaching involves cooking food gently in simmering liquid between 160degF and 180degF, preserving moisture and texture with direct heat application. A poaching pan designed for this method offers wide surface area and shallow depth for even heat distribution and easy access to ingredients. Sous vide machines provide precise temperature control by immersing vacuum-sealed food in water baths, ensuring consistent, tender results without overcooking, surpassing traditional poaching in accuracy and repeatability.

What Is a Poaching Pan?

A poaching pan is a specialized cookware designed to gently cook delicate foods like eggs, fish, and poultry in simmering water. This pan features a deep, elongated shape with a fitted rack that separates food from direct heat, ensuring even cooking and easy retrieval. Unlike a sous vide machine, which uses precise temperature control and vacuum sealing, a poaching pan relies on consistent water temperature for traditional poaching methods.

Temperature Control: Manual vs. Precision

Poaching pans rely on manual temperature control, requiring constant attention to maintain the ideal water temperature between 160degF and 180degF, which can lead to inconsistent results. This method depends heavily on user experience to prevent overcooking or undercooking delicate foods like eggs or fish.

Sous vide machines offer precise temperature control with digital settings that maintain exact temperatures for extended periods, usually within +-0.1degF accuracy. This precision ensures evenly cooked food while minimizing the risk of overcooking, making it ideal for sensitive proteins.

Ease of Use: Poaching Pan vs Sous Vide

Poaching pans offer straightforward use with simple controls suitable for beginners, while sous vide machines provide precise temperature regulation that requires initial setup knowledge. The poaching pan's open design allows easy monitoring, whereas sous vide machines rely on sealed bags and immersion immersion circulators for cooking consistency.

Users find poaching pans easier for quick, casual meals since they involve less equipment and cleanup. Sous vide machines excel in precision and repeatability, making them ideal for detailed culinary tasks but with a steeper learning curve. Both methods have specific advantages depending on user preference for control versus simplicity in poaching techniques.

Equipment Cost and Kitchen Space

Poaching pans typically require a lower initial investment compared to sous vide machines, making them more accessible for budget-conscious kitchens. They also occupy less counter space than the often bulkier sous vide equipment, which can be a crucial factor in small or crowded kitchens.

  • Lower Equipment Cost - Poaching pans are generally less expensive than sous vide machines, reducing upfront kitchen expenses.
  • Compact Kitchen Footprint - Poaching pans take up minimal space, ideal for limited kitchen areas.
  • Minimal Setup Required - Poaching pans need no additional tools, unlike sous vide machines which require precise temperature controls and water baths.

Best Foods for Each Poaching Method

Poaching pans excel at cooking delicate foods like eggs, fish, and fruits evenly through gentle simmering, allowing flavors to infuse without breaking the texture. Their shallow design provides precise temperature control ideal for items that require careful handling and quick cooking.

Sous vide machines, on the other hand, are perfect for poaching meats, poultry, and vegetables at a consistent low temperature over extended periods, enhancing tenderness and flavor retention. Vacuum-sealed bags help maintain moisture and nutrients, producing restaurant-quality results with minimal supervision.
